If  I purchased ICN at  the ICO, does that qualify me to buy both ICNX and ICNP? I have bought some ICNX on the new platform, but it doesn't give me the option to purchase ICNP? How do I get my hands on those goodies?


You cannot purchase ICNP directly. When buying ICN, you are basically buying ICNP in return. This is because 20% of the ICNP return is going towards buybacks and burning of ICN coins and the other 80% is for reinvestment in other ICOs to get more profits. So if you owe 10% of total ICN coins, well basically you owns 10% of ICNP + all the other fees which is generated on ICNX
Does it mean if I own 500 icn,I will get 500 icnp also? And can I sell one (icn or icnp) and keep other?


No. The ONLY thing that the ICNP does is buy back ICN tokens with 20% of the profits it generates. Therefore, the only way to benefit from the ICNP fund is to own ICN tokens.
